Filmmaker Jules Rosskam explores the issues of the transgendered community and how they interact with the gay culture and mainstream America in this documentary. Against A Trans Narrative includes performance pieces and interviews with thirty-six different people representing a broad cross section of age, race and gender as they confront a variety of topics including the role of gender in feminism, masculinity as it defines (and is defined by) the trans community, sexism and queer politics as they apply to the transgendered, relationship issues, debating the necessity of defining ones self through gender, the politics behind "passing" as another gender, and how age impacts the decision of what gender to embrace. The actors and crew who worked on the film also take part in the on-screen debate, allowing their own experiences and views to become part of the film's perspective. Against A Trans Narrative was an official selection at the 2009 San Francisco International LGBT Film Festival. ~ Mark Deming, Rovi
